MOBILE NUMBER PORTABILITY (MNP)

1.       MNP is the ability of the Subscriber to change from one mobile service provider to another mobile service provider without changing their mobile number subject to the terms and conditions herein appearing. A prepaid and/or BLACK Subscriber who wishes to port is required to submit a ‘port in’ request to XOX MOBILE and is subject to XOX MOBILE’s existing terms and conditions for new registration and to existing geographical numbering requirements.

2.       Subscriber must satisfy these prerequisite conditions for a successful MNP:

a.       The current mobile number must be active at the time of the request;

b.       Subscriber must provide valid identifications including, but not limited to, Identification card, Armed Forces Identification Card and/or passport;

c.       Subscriber must not have any outstanding and/or overdue amounts/contractual obligations with the current mobile service provider;

d.       The mobile numbers must be in the range of mobile numbers as approved by MCMC time to time;

e.       Upon request, the Subscriber must provide all other information as required from XOX MOBILE;

f.        Subject always to XOX MOBILE’s terms and conditions prevailing at the time of the request as stipulated on XOX's official website.

3.       Subscribers who wish to port in must adhere to the terms and conditions including the procedures and processes prevailing at the time of request to port in as outlined by XOX MOBILE which can be found in ONEXOX's Official Website at https://onexox.my/ from time to time. Any port in shall be treated as a new application and is subject to XOX MOBILE’s terms and conditions herein contained and represent a notice to terminate any agreement that the Customer has with the current mobile service operator.

4.       All services associated with the ported-out mobile number provided by XOX MOBILE will be terminated when the SIM card is deactivated.

5.       Any call(s) or SMS or MMS or any other means of communications initiated by the Subscriber to the mobile number(s) that have ported out from XOX MOBILE will be charged as per XOX MOBILE's standard charges applicable to inter-network communications.

6.       Any fees imposed by XOX MOBILE for the porting request are not refundable in any event whatsoever.

7.       XOX MOBILE shall not be responsible and/or liable for any interruption and/or delay in approving and/or providing the Service to the Subscriber caused by the Customer's current mobile service operator.

8.       Any failed MNP port in will be refunded to Subscribers after they submit inquiries to XOX Customer Service.

 

TERMINATION AND REFUND

1.       The Subscriber may terminate the subscription by contacting XOX’s careline or by completing the termination form and forwarding the same to XOX MOBILE within seven (7) working days before the Subscriber’s next billing cycle. Termination form may be sent to XOX via email to enquiries@xox.com.my or at any authorised XOX MOBILE centres.

2.       Upon termination, XOX MOBILE reserves the right to forfeit all unused subscription which includes but not limited to unused credit, data, talk time, SMS and/or loyalty points.

3.       The Subscriber may clear the payment settlement by utilizing their overpaid balance in the billing system. If any overpayments remain after the Subscribers have settled their bills, Subscribers must contact XOX Customer Service to request for a refund.

4.       The overpayment in the Subscriber’s account can be used to clear the bill. Subscribers may request for a refund if there is still a balance after paying the bill.

5.       In the event of termination, any amount from Advance Payment shall be forfeited. There is no cash refund for Advance Payment.

6.       The Subscriber may request for a refund of Deposit (if any) a day after the termination of the subscription and within THIRTY (30) days with the provision of his/her Bank account. XOX is not liable for any charges imposed by Banks that are not registered in Malaysia. There is no cash refund for Deposit.

7.       XOX reserves the right to utilize the Deposit to offset any amount due from the Subscriber to XOX including but not limited to any outstanding charges under any of your Accounts.

8.       Subject to the above, any balance Deposit will be returned to the Subscriber within fourteen (14) working days from the date of the refund request.

9.       In the event the Subscriber’s subscription is terminated due to overdue unpaid charges, XOX MOBILE shall not be liable for any payment or refund of unused subscription, credit and/or monies upon termination of the Agreement. In such event and with no prior notice, the Subscriber loses all rights and/or entitlement previously accumulated including but not limited to unused credit, monies, data, talk time, SMS, loyalty points, E-Wallet credit under the Subscriber’s subscription.

10.   Upon line termination, XOX MOBILE reserves the right to use Subscriber’s E-Wallet balance to reduce/settle any outstanding amount/balance. Any reduction made from E-Wallet balance shall not be deemed as full and final settlement of any outstanding amount/balance. Subscriber shall still be responsible and liable to settle any amount owing and due to XOX MOBILE.

11.   Termination shall be without prejudice to any existing rights and/or claims that XOX MOBILE may have against the Subscriber and the Subscriber shall continue to fulfil his/her obligations including full payment of all outstanding charges prior to the date of termination.

12.   XOX MOBILE may, without any liability to the Subscriber, terminate and suspend all or any part of the Service without giving any reason.

 

Beginning 1st January 2020, in the event BLACK Subscribers fail to clear their outstanding payment, XOX MOBILE reserves the right to share their information with Credit Rating Agencies, at any time without referring to the Subscriber. This may affect the Subscriber’s credit standing and eligibility in obtaining financial products moving forward.

FAIR USAGE POLICY

1.       By accepting the XOX Terms and Conditions for Service, Subscribers agree to be bound by this Policy.

2.       XOX Fair Usage Policy is intended to ensure that Subscribers do not use XOX Services in an excessive, unreasonable, or fraudulent manner. Such usage may impact the quality or reliability of XOX Services.

3.       These policies apply when Subscribers use any of special offers giving calls, texts, photos, or data usage for free or at rates lower than XOX MOBILE standard rates for, or unlimited access to, such calls, texts, photos, or data usage.

4.       Subscribers are prohibited from using the Services which can compromise the security or tamper with XOX system resources or accounts on XOX systems, or at any other site accessible via XOX systems.

5.       XOX MOBILE network is a shared resource, and Subscribers agree to use the Services, in a considerate manner, which must not unfairly exploit the usage, affect the experience of other Subscribers, or cause us loss – for example, but not limited to, the Services for reselling purposes, unreasonable bandwidth consumption, or accessing services which are prohibited under the Terms and Conditions for Service or using unauthorized devices.

6.       Subscribers will be held responsible for the security of devices that are directly or indirectly connected to XOX MOBILE network.

7.       For XOX MOBILE Data Plan, Subscriber’s total usage per month shall NOT exceed from the allocated data volume transmitted (total upload and download usage). This is to ensure that no Subscriber can congest the bandwidth at all times.

8.       If Subscribers are found to be in violation of this policy, we may, at XOX MOBILE’s option and discretion manage Subscriber’s bandwidth, suspend, or terminate the Services (with or without notice as XOX MOBILE may consider appropriate).

9.       To report any illegal or unacceptable use of the Services, please send an email to enquiries@xox.com.my.

10.   This policy is supplemental and shall be read together as an integral part of terms and conditions of governing the Services and its relevant addendum. If there is any inconsistency between the Policy and the terms and conditions of the Services, the terms and conditions governing the Services posted on the website will prevail.

11.   For the avoidance of doubt, the calculation that XOX MOBILE uses to calculate the kilobytes for the Internet data quota is as follows:

a.       1GB = 1,024MB

b.       1MB = 1,024KB

c.       1GB = 1,048,576KB

E-WALLET

1.       XOX E-Wallet is an electronic wallet that holds electronic money (e-money).

2.       Subscribers may use XOX E-Wallet credit for bill payment, Season Pass and Happy Hour purchase and/or any other services to be added on by XOX MOBILE from time to time.

3.       The XOX E-Wallet top up is capped at Ringgit Malaysia Two Hundred (RM200) and the system will not allow the excess amount to be kept. The excess of E-Wallet will be converted as Airtime credit for Prepaid Subscribers. Meanwhile, the excess for E-Wallet will be converted as bill payment for BLACK Subscribers.

4.       XOX has the discretion to utilize the Subscriber’s E-Wallet balance to offset amounts due and payable for any XOX Products or Services which remains outstanding under the Subscriber’s account.

5.       In the event when Subscribers want to terminate or port out from their Prepaid or BLACK account, Subscribers may request a refund for the E-Wallet balance amount. The E-Wallet balance will be refunded within fourteen (14) working days from the date of successful refund request.

6.       Upon Subscriber’s termination of service, XOX reserves the right to use Subscriber’s E-Wallet balance to reduce/settle any outstanding balance.

7.       There is no fee imposed for using the XOX E-Wallet unless indicated otherwise.
